I believe with the rapid speed of developments in AI video and audio, not only will we reach that stage of replacing an actor, we won’t even need a human actor in the first place to replace, and it’s not going to take another 10 years to get there.

This is largely why there is still an actor’s strike going on right now. Corporate Hollywood wants actors to sign over their digital rights, knowing full well what AI will be capable of in the next few years. The studios intend to put A-list actors in movies digitally, and the actors are not accepting that fate without a fight.
